diff options
author | Noel Grandin <noel.grandin@collabora.co.uk> | 2020-01-24 12:04:55 +0200 |
---|---|---|
committer | Noel Grandin <noel.grandin@collabora.co.uk> | 2020-01-24 12:54:18 +0100 |
commit | 3e4cad1f4b4a6a07b516a0d205d642a985e17484 (patch) | |
tree | 8b25c97118c6743498c95379b12feba986f6e668 /sdext/source/presenter/PresenterController.cxx | |
parent | 387200f2ddccaa8cd0b0d61943c6d7f480a0931a (diff) |
loplugin:makeshared in sdext
Change-Id: Ia4148faff7e99baa2f29c86feab5a7ce3d9d0ff6
Reviewed-on: https://gerrit.libreoffice.org/c/core/+/87330
Tested-by: Jenkins
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Diffstat (limited to 'sdext/source/presenter/PresenterController.cxx')
-rw-r--r-- | sdext/source/presenter/PresenterController.cxx |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/sdext/source/presenter/PresenterController.cxx b/sdext/source/presenter/PresenterController.cxx index b26dfc2fb3af..d2aad85c86cf 100644 --- a/sdext/source/presenter/PresenterController.cxx +++ b/sdext/source/presenter/PresenterController.cxx @@ -105,7 +105,7 @@ PresenterController::PresenterController ( mpTheme(), mxMainWindow(), mpPaneBorderPainter(), - mpCanvasHelper(new PresenterCanvasHelper()), + mpCanvasHelper(std::make_shared<PresenterCanvasHelper>()), mxPresenterHelper(), mpPaintManager(), mnPendingSlideNumber(-1), @@ -1068,7 +1068,7 @@ void PresenterController::InitializeMainPane (const Reference<XPane>& rxPane) if (xPane2.is()) xPane2->setVisible(true); - mpPaintManager.reset(new PresenterPaintManager(mxMainWindow, mxPresenterHelper, mpPaneContainer)); + mpPaintManager = std::make_shared<PresenterPaintManager>(mxMainWindow, mxPresenterHelper, mpPaneContainer); mxCanvas.set(rxPane->getCanvas(), UNO_QUERY); @@ -1082,7 +1082,7 @@ void PresenterController::LoadTheme (const Reference<XPane>& rxPane) { // Create (load) the current theme. if (rxPane.is()) - mpTheme.reset(new PresenterTheme(mxComponentContext, rxPane->getCanvas())); + mpTheme = std::make_shared<PresenterTheme>(mxComponentContext, rxPane->getCanvas()); } double PresenterController::GetSlideAspectRatio() const |